Aquinas Consulting is currently looking to fill a Project Planner job for our direct client. In this role, you will oversee the manufacturing process for assigned projects across multiple facilities, ensuring timely delivery and accurate documentation. This role involves close collaboration with Project Management, Design Teams, and Supply Chain to track project status, assign inventory, and manage production scheduling.
Project Planner job Responsibilities :
- Create and maintain detailed project status reports.
- Assign product inventory to required projects and system sections.
- Track and report on the project lifecycle through manufacturing.
- Work with Supply Chain to initiate fiber orders and provide set length requirements.
- Issue Manufacturing Instructions to Production Schedulers.
- Collaborate with Project Management to address project risks and changes.
- Schedule and attend meetings with Marine Services, Project Management, and Design Teams.
- Ensure manufacturing documentation is completed on time.
- Review ERP demand for accuracy and escalate issues as needed.
- Proactively resolve project delays by coordinating with stakeholders.
